Information flow delays in supply chains reduce revenue by up to 20%

Delays in real-time information and material flow within manufacturing supply chains directly correlate with lost sales revenue, with information delays having a more significant impact than material delays.

Journal of theoretical and applied electronic commerce research · 2008

01

Key Findings

  • 01There is a direct relationship between delay times in information and material flow and lost sales revenue.
  • 02Information delays contribute more significantly to lost sales revenue than material delays.

Method & Evidence

AimTo quantify the impact of information and material flow delays on lost sales revenue within a manufacturing supply chain.
MethodDiscrete Event Simulation
ProcedureThe study utilized discrete event simulation, specifically modeling the Beer Distribution Game, to analyze the effects of varying levels of information and material delays on sales revenue.
ContextManufacturing Supply Chains

Limitations

Simulations are models, and real-world factors like human error or unexpected events can further complicate supply chain dynamics.

Reliability & validity

The use of discrete event simulation provides a controlled environment to test variables, enhancing internal validity. However, external validity may be limited by the specific model used (Beer Distribution Game).
